Honey Bee Relocation in Hillsboro
Live removal of honey bee colonies from walls, attics, and trees. Bees go to local beekeepers β never exterminated. Available throughout Hillsboro and surrounding west communities.
Swarm Capture in Hillsboro
Bee swarms are docile and temporary. We capture within hours and relocate to a managed hive. Available throughout Hillsboro and surrounding west communities.
Structural Bee Removal in Hillsboro
Colonies in walls, chimneys, and roofs require careful extraction. Full comb removal and repair included. Available throughout Hillsboro and surrounding west communities.
Carpenter Bee Control in Hillsboro
Unlike honey bees, carpenter bees drill into wood. Targeted treatment of bore holes and wood repair. Available throughout Hillsboro and surrounding west communities.
